Albert Joseph Moore
A portrait of the Scottish art collector William Connal, Jr. by Albert Joseph Moore, capturing the sitter with refined light and a restrained palette.
This portrait depicts William Connal, Jr., a prominent Scottish merchant and art collector who maintained close ties with the Aesthetic Movement. Albert Joseph Moore, known for his focus on decorative harmony and classical motifs, captures his subject with a directness that departs from his typical allegorical compositions. The painting displays a refined handling of light, which illuminates the sitter's face against a dark, textured background. The craquelure visible across the surface provides a sense of the work's age and material history. Moore employs a restrained palette, allowing the subtle variations in skin tone and the texture of the subject's light-coloured jacket to command attention. The sitter's expression is composed, reflecting the quiet dignity often sought by Victorian portraitists. A small, distinctive shell motif is visible on the left side of the composition, a signature element frequently included by Moore in his works to denote his artistic identity. The brushwork is precise, demonstrating the artist's technical control and his ability to render form through light rather than heavy contouring. William Connal was a significant patron of the arts, and his association with Moore suggests a shared appreciation for the principles of art for art's sake. This portrait functions as a study of character, stripped of the elaborate drapery or architectural settings that define much of Moore's larger output. By focusing on the individual, the artist provides a glimpse into the social circles of the late nineteenth-century British art world. The work remains a clear example of the portraiture style prevalent among artists who prioritised formal balance and tonal control over narrative complexity. It offers a view into the personal connections that supported the development of the Aesthetic Movement in Britain.
